Lloyds Enterprises: Up 2337%, this penny stock turned ₹1 lakh into ₹24 lakh in 4 years

[ad_1] Penny stock Lloyds Enterprises has posted multibagger returns in the last 4 years, rising from ₹1.19 in March 2020 to around ₹28.8 currently. This implies a return of almost 2337%. An investment of ₹1 lakh in this stock in March 2020 would have turned into over ₹24 lakh now. Lloyds Enterprises Limited trades in iron and steel products in India. Paytm shares can cross ₹500, believes Motilal Oswal, sees 30% upside

[ad_1] Recent developments have shown promise for Paytm, as it obtained approval from the National Payments Council of India (NPCI) to operate as a third-party app, allowing it to function similarly to competitors like Google Pay and PhonePe. Moreover, Paytm has forged partnerships with Axis Bank, HDFC Bank, SBI, and Yes Bank to facilitate seamless business migration, indicating proactive measures to address operational concerns. Rupee rebounds 14 paise to 83.05 against dollar as U.S. Fed indicates 3 rate cuts

[ad_1] Image used for representational purpose. | Photo Credit: Reuters The rupee rebounded 14 paise to 83.05 against the U.S. currency in early trade on Thursday as the dollar retreated from high levels in global markets after the U.S. Federal Reserve indicated three rate cuts this year.
